TumblrPics.com
HOME
DMCA
Live
Gallery
Viewer
Hachishakusama
fitness expert
horrorterrors
tetrarchy
horror comedy
deadalive
LIVE
Hachishakusama is a tall, female Yokai found in Japan. Hachishakusama’s name translates to “Eight-Fe
Hachishakusama is a tall, female Yokai found in Japan. Hachishakusama’s name translates to&nbs
Prev Page
Next Page